To reach Minneapolis from Old Lyme, flying is the most practical method. Depart from Bradley International Airport (BDL) and fly to Minneapolis-Saint Paul International Airport (MSP). Flights typically involve a connection, with a total travel time of about 5-6 hours. Driving is a 20-hour journey covering over 1,300 miles via I-84 West and I-90 West. There is no direct rail service to Minneapolis from the East Coast.
Total Distance: Driving distance 2,100 km, straight-line air distance 1,700 km.
MSP is a major hub for Delta, offering many connection options.
